Frequently Asked Questions about Frozen Boysenberries VS Frozen Carrots

What are the health benefits of Frozen Boysenberries compared to Frozen Carrots?

Both frozen boysenberries and frozen carrots are nutritious options. Boysenberries are rich in antioxidants, vitamins C and K, and dietary fiber, which can support immune function and digestive health. Carrots are high in beta-carotene, vitamin A, and fiber, promoting healthy vision and skin. Including a variety of fruits and vegetables in your diet is key to obtaining a wide range of nutrients for overall health.

What is the environmental impact of producing Frozen Boysenberries compared to Frozen Carrots?

Producing frozen boysenberries generally has a higher environmental impact compared to frozen carrots due to factors such as water usage, pesticide use, transportation emissions, and packaging. Boysenberries require more water and pesticides to grow, and they are often transported longer distances. Carrots, on the other hand, are more water-efficient and generally require fewer pesticides. Choosing locally grown and organic options for both boysenberries and carrots can help reduce the environmental impact of their production.
